The Inca Trail Adventure was the best vacation I've ever been on. I liked how we had a few days before trekking to Machu Picchu to acclimate to the high altitude, learn about the different ancient cultures of Peru, and even got to do some light hiking, explore ruins, and visit a small town where we saw a guinea pig farm, visited the town's only stove, and learned how to make Peruvian corn beer. We had 2 separate guided the first 2 days and they were wonderful. The trekking portion on the Ancascocha Trail was so special and unbelievable. We were the only hikers on the trail. We felt well supported with 7 horses/donkeys, 2 cooks, and 2 horsemen. Our guide Carlos was amazing. He did a wonderful job showing us the lay of the land, guiding us through the local's farmlands and mountains. We hiked fast so Carlos decided to do 2 days of hiking in 1 and we were rewarded with good hiking and a nicer place to stay for 2 nights instead of 1. We did a bonus hike and one of the cooks who lived there used a machete up a mountain so we can get amazing views. The food and the sights of this trip were top notch.
